Transaction 42cd0d5935b21a8e85af74232a1ecb548aa1cf26af1df83f52db86b6a7e92aa7
1 Input
1 Output
-
42cd0d5935b21a8e85af74232a1ecb548aa1cf26af1df83f52db86b6a7e92aa7:0
- value
- 24058954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d3fef624ab397bf1be6c55179de04dfd5bf9e32 OP_EQUAL
- address
- MEwcrVLHrD1xEXzJNj7tjz236iDGjgDatt